$17.00 to $20.00/ hour depending on experience (The Clerical Position has a Pay Scale consisting of the following elements and ranges. Wages include Base Hourly Compensation of $17.00 to $20.00/ hour.)
Job Description Duties and Responsibilities:
Receipt all monies received for new and used car deals and dealer trades. Organize all paperwork in each deal; check for completeness (signatures, verify VIN, etc.) Process dealer trades in and out. Cashier Any other duties as assigned by supervisor Must follow all company safety policies and procedures, and immediately report any and all accidents to a manager or supervisor Computer literate; accurate with 10 key pad and typing Self-motivated; able to effectively prioritize tasks and organize schedule Basic working knowledge of accounting. Good interpersonal and oral communication skills. Mathematical aptitude All applicants must be authorized to work in the USA All applicants must perform duties and responsibilities in a safe manner All applicants must be able to demonstrate ability to pass pre-employment testing to include background checks, MVR, drug test, credit report, and valid driver license .It's time to make the most important move of your career .
